Flying lab to investigate Southern Ocean's appetite for carbon

Tuesday, January 5, 2016 - 14:13 in Earth & Climate

A team of scientists is launching a series of research flights this month over the remote Southern Ocean in an effort to better understand just how much carbon dioxide the icy waters are able to lock away.
